Flynn's "discovery" and "increases mainly among the less able"

Flynn did NOT "discover" the increase over time. Thorndike (1975), for example, provides detailed documentation of the relative increases on sub-scales of the Binet and proffers a range of possible explanations that are still being touted today. Raven (1981), re-published in Raven (2000), demonstrated the increases on the Raven Progressive Matrices among young people in the UK. What Flynn did (using the RPM!) was demonstrate that the effect was almost worldwide, ie not confined to the US and UK, and draw attention to the implication that these scores had been subject to a massive, and previously unsuspected, environmental impact which had implications for the interpretation placed on cultural differences. What he failed to do, and still to some extent, fails to do in continuing to offer his "basket-ball" analogy, is recognise that whatever explanation is accepted has also to explain dramatic international increases in such things as height and life expectancy.

As to the increases being concentrated at the lower end, what the adult data re-published in Raven (2000) show is that, as Flynn suggested, the data, reported by many previous researchers, that had previously been interpreted as showing a decrease in many abilities with increasing age must be re-interpreted as showing that there has been a dramatic increase in these abilities with date of birth. On many tests this occcurs at all levels of ability. Thus there is now abundant evidence that it is not true that the increase has been concentrated in the lower end of the distribution (and there are, in fact, horrendous measurement problems involved in substantiating any such claim). Tall people have got still taller: the whole distribution has moved up.

Having cited this evidence, I am re-inserting the material that someone deleted at the beginning of this month. However, since it would overweight the introductory paragraph to refer to these other studies at this point I am confining the alteration to simply saying that Flynn drew general attention to the increase and its implications.

Huh. I've just noticed that there isn't even a reference to Flynn's publications in the entry! I've inserted a couple.

Raven, J. (2000). The Raven’s Progressive Matrices: Change and stability over culture and time. Cognitive Psychology, 41, 1-48.

Thorndike, R. L. (1975). Mr. Binet's Test 70 Years Later. Presidential Address to the American Educational Research Association.

I certainly appreciate your concerns, and the issue of cultural bias in IQ tests is a significant and important issue, however I don't believe it holds water here. First, as the disscussant above noted, the Flynn effect is in fact most pronounced in homogenous, white European cultures. Now you argue that this may be further evidence of the growth of a "European standard" but I think you would be hard pressed to prove that the Dutch (for example) are significantly MORE homogenous or European now than they were 40 years ago! Yet the Flynn effect is clear there....
A second and perhaps more compelling argument stems from the fact that the Flynn effect is, if anything, more pronounced when we assess people with tests that are the LEAST culturally biased. Psychologists have individually adminsitered IQ tests that are purely non-verbal and can be administered with no verbal directions to persons with no formal education. These tests apparently show the least cultural bias (e.g. differences between cultural/ethnic/racial groups are lowest on these tests) yet the Flynn effect is, if anything, stronger with them. Rise of IQ scores vs. rise of IQ test norms

The article is somewhat misleading. IQ scores cannot rise - they are periodically recalibrated to have an average of 100. The Flynn effect is the IQ test standards gettig higher and higher, ie. previous generations would have scored lower on today's tests and the current generation higher on earlier tests. I cannot find Flynn's article online, but its abstract is clear about this:

"Demonstrates that every Stanford-Binet Intelligence Scale, WISC, WAIS, WISC-R, WAIS-R, and WPPSI standardization sample from 1932 to 1978 established norms of a higher standard than its predecessor. The obvious interpretation of this pattern is that representative samples of Americans did better and better on IQ tests over a period of 46 yrs, the total gain amounting to a rise in mean IQ of 13.8 points."

The article is certainly incomplete, but your claims are incorrect. An IQ score is normalized to mean 100 based on a representative sample of maybe N=1000 people. The actual population mean will be something around 100, but not precisely 100. If some kind of relavent demongraphic shift were to occur after the normalization, then mean IQ would truly change. This change could be counter-balanced by re-normalizing against a new representative sample. However, this does not change the fact that the average scores did change. Only the renormalization complicates this. If you look at a graph of average scores per year, you'll see that scores were increasing relatively constantly between normalization years with sharp drops after re-normalization -- the Flynn effect. --Rikurzhen 03:27, 18 April 2006 (UTC)[reply]

This sourced material has been removed: "There are many different kinds of IQ tests using a wide variety of methods. Some tests are visual, some are verbal, some tests only use of abstract-reasoning problems, and some tests concentrate on arithmetic, spatial imagery, reading, vocabulary, memory or general knowledge. The psychologist Charles Spearman early this century made the first formal factor analysis of correlations between the tests. He found that a single common factor explained for the positive correlations among test. This is an argument still accepted in principle by many psychometricians. Spearman named it g for "general intelligence factor." In any collections of IQ tests, by definition the test that best measures g is the one that has the highest correlations with all the others. Most of these g-loaded tests typically involve some form of abstract reasoning. Therefore Spearman and others have regarded g as the perhaps genetically determined real essence of intelligence. This is still a common but not proven view. Other factor analyses of the data are with different results are possible. Some psychometricians regard g as a statistical artifact. The accepted best measure of g is Raven's Progressive Matrices which is a test of visual reasoning."
